LSHL values its Employees

LSHL is an inclusive organisation committed to fairness, equality of opportunity and diversity in all its employment practices, policies, and procedures. LSHL is committed to ensuring it has a healthy and educated workforce whose views are listened to and respected. LSHL nurtures ambition and ensures that all employees are able to develop relevant skills and knowledge to enrich their contribution and carve their own career path.

LSHL has been accredited as a Living Wage employer. The Real Living Wage is an amount that exceeds the statutory National Living Wage. Achieving accreditation as a Living Wage employer is recognition that LSHL is committed to paying employees a wage that meets the cost of living.

LSHL’s commitment to the Real Living Wage is a reflection of its commitment to fair pay and recognising the value of its employees.

LSHL’s CSR Statement in practice - Some Examples

The landlords of LSHL’s offices in Yorkshire are committed to development projects that build and improve communities.

A supportive culture is actively promoted at LSHL in its behaviours and policies. Remote, part-time, and flexible working are supported, and the benefits and rewards encourage development, work life balance and employee well-being.

The LINK Consumer Council and the Financial Inclusion Programme were established in 2006 putting the consumer at the heart of everything LSHL does and helping to sustain communities.

Each year, employees are invited to vote for a charity to support throughout the year. LSHL has introduced volunteer days for all employees. These may be spent supporting LSHL’s chosen charity or another charity meaningful to them. In addition, funds are raised throughout the year for the chosen and other charities through various events and supporting employees in their own fundraising activities.
